The cheapest way to get from Remagen to Mainz is to drive which costs €16 - €25 and takes 1h 49m.
The fastest way to get from Remagen to Mainz is to train via Koblenz which takes 1h 38m and costs €25 - €65.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Remagen Bf and arriving at Mainz, Hauptbahnhof.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 1m.
The distance between Remagen and Mainz is 130 km. The road distance is 119.9 km.
The best way to get from Remagen to Mainz without a car is to train via Koblenz which takes 1h 38m and costs €25 - €65.
It takes approximately 1h 38m to get from Remagen to Mainz, including transfers.
